Method 1: Unveiling Hidden Listings on Zillow

Zillow, a popular online real estate marketplace, can be a valuable tool in your search for a rental property. While browsing through listings, you might come across properties currently available for rent. However, keep in mind that many others will be vying for the same property, resulting in fierce competition.

To increase your chances of success, dig deeper into the property’s history. Scroll down the listing page and look for the name of the realtor or the contact person offering the property. By reaching out to them, you’ll likely find yourself in line with numerous other applicants.

But here’s the secret: Instead of focusing solely on currently available properties, pay attention to the price history of other homes in the same neighborhood. Click on houses nearby and explore their price history. Look specifically for properties that were listed for rent in the past, especially during the months close to your current search period.

For example, if it’s June, look for properties listed in August or July of previous years. These listings indicate annual lease renewals, meaning the property may become available around the same time each year. Armed with this knowledge, you can take a proactive approach.

Write a well-crafted letter to the property owner about a month before their current tenant’s lease is set to renew. Introduce yourself, highlighting your reliable income, good credit, and positive rental references. Express your desire to find a home in their neighborhood and kindly request they consider you as a potential tenant if their property becomes available for rent. By being organized, proactive, and professional, you might catch the owner’s attention and secure a home before it hits the market.

One additional advantage is that by renting directly from the property owner, you can potentially save on broker fees that would otherwise be paid if you went through a real estate agent. This win-win situation allows the owner to find a responsible tenant while saving money, and you to secure your dream home without facing fierce competition.

Method 2: Unveiling Rental Properties through Tax Records

Tax records can provide valuable insights into potential rental properties. By searching for properties in the area where you wish to live, you can uncover hidden rental opportunities. Begin by exploring tax records available online, focusing on the site address and the mailing address mentioned in the records.

If the site address and mailing address are different, it suggests that the property owner does not live on-site. This could indicate that the property is either a rental or a second home. While not all properties with different addresses are rentals, this method allows you to identify potential rental opportunities.

Craft a personalized letter and send it to the property owner’s mailing address. Introduce yourself, express your interest in renting a property in their area, and provide details about your reliable income, good credit, and strong rental references. By reaching out to property owners directly, you have the opportunity to get ahead of the competition and secure a rental before it becomes widely available.

Remember, this method requires patience and persistence, as not all properties with different addresses will turn out to be rentals. However, by exploring tax records and targeting specific subdivisions or streets, you increase your chances of finding hidden gems that others might overlook.

Conclusion:

In highly competitive rental markets, finding a property can be a challenge. By employing these two secret methods, you can gain an advantage and secure your dream home. Utilize Zillow to uncover properties with a rental history and reach out to property owners proactively. Additionally, explore tax records to identify properties where the mailing address differs from the site address, indicating a potential rental opportunity.

Be organized, proactive, and professional in your communications, highlighting your positive attributes as a tenant. By taking the initiative and thinking outside the box, you can increase your chances of finding a rental property and avoid the intense competition often associated with popular listings.
